The PGY1 Pharmacy Residency at Wyckoff Heights Medical Center will develop the graduate into a clinical pharmacist with the ability to function within a health system. The resident will rotate through 12 months of inpatient and ambulatory patient care experiences to foster independent clinical decision making through established collaborative drug therapy management agreements. Residents will have the opportunity to obtain a teaching certificate through an affiliated school of pharmacy. They will have a faculty appointment at Touro College of Pharmacy, with opportunities to teach small group didactic academic sessions. Residents will complete at least one longitudinal research project, and present the results at a peer reviewed professional meeting. The PGY2 Internal Medicine Pharmacy Residency at Wyckoff Heights Medical Center is designed to develop the resident into a highly-trained, independent pharmacotherapy specialist with advanced expertise in internal medicine. Rotations offered include internal medicine, cardiology, infectious diseases, ambulatory care, critical care, and emergency medicine. Other longitudinal experiences involve a research project, formal presentations, hospital committees, and student teaching opportunities. Additionally, the resident will become BLS/ACLS certified, complete CITI training for biomedical research, co-precept student pharmacists and pharmacy residents, teach pharmacotherapy recitations and physical assessment at the Touro College of Pharmacy, complete a Teaching or Leadership Certificate program, participate in continuing education programs, and attend regional and national pharmacy conferences.
Graduated from ACPE-accredited Doctor of Pharmacy (PharmD) (Minimum GPA 3.0). Eligible for licensure in New York State. Curriculum vitae, letter of intent, academic transcriptions, three letters of recommendation.
About Wyckoff Heights Medical Center
Wyckoff Heights Medical Center is a 350-bed teaching hospital located in an ethnically diverse neighborhood in northern Brooklyn, New York. Since 1889, WHMC has been committed to providing a single standard of highest quality care to the community through prevention, education, and treatment in a safe environment. WHMC's variety of services include adult and pediatric emergency departments, designated stroke center, internal medicine, intensive care, cardiology, surgery, obstetrics and gynecology, and ambulatory care.
